Smoke detectors are fundamental devices designed to alert individuals of smoke or fire hazards. They utilize different signaling methods, predominantly beeps, chirps, or consistent alarms. Each pattern indicates specific conditions of the device or its environment.
When a smoke detector produces three beeps, it typically serves as a warning signal. This pattern is often associated with smoke detection systems that are designed to indicate a specific, critical condition. The sound of three consecutive beeps can vary slightly depending on the manufacturer, but in most cases, it signifies an immediate concern that requires action.
In many instances, three beeps signify the detection of smoke or fire within the vicinity. The sophisticated sensors embedded within the smoke detector respond to the presence of smoke particles in the air, triggering this alert. It is imperative to treat this indication with urgency. Upon hearing three beeps, individuals should promptly check for signs of fire or smoke, ensuring their safety by potentially evacuating the premises. It’s a call to assess one’s immediate surroundings carefully.
However, it is also essential to consider the limitations of this alarm. Sometimes, smoke particles might not be the sole reason behind the alarm’s sound. In certain scenarios, three beeps can signify that the smoke detector is malfunctioning or requires maintenance. This underlines the importance of understanding the specific characteristics of the smoke detector in your residence or workplace. Each device may have unique operational guidelines; therefore, referring to the instructional manual to decipher the alerts accurately is wise.
In the unlikely event that the smoke detector sounds three beeps in the absence of smoke or fire, it may necessitate further investigation into the device’s functionality. It could indicate technological issues such as low battery levels or sensor anomalies. Most smoke detectors incorporate a low battery alert mechanism that can manifest as sporadic beeping patterns, which can often be confused with more urgent alarms. Therefore, if three beeps persist without any visible hazards, evaluating battery status or exploring potential obstructions or dust buildup within the device may be prudent.
Safety protocols dictate several actions upon hearing these signals. Immediately verification of the environment for smoke or fire is paramount. If confirmed, evacuate occupants and alert emergency services. In the absence of visible dangers, a systematic check of the smoke detector should be undertaken. If necessary, cleaning or replacing the battery could eliminate potential false alarms.
Regular maintenance is vital for maintaining the effectiveness of your smoke detector. Experts recommend monthly testing of the device to ensure it operates correctly. In addition, the batteries should be replaced at least once a year, or as per the manufacturer’s guidelines. As with any other safety device, age can also affect reliability; smoke detectors typically require replacement every 10 years, ensuring that you have the most current technology for detecting dangers.
